Ashton Jeanty: From Military Roots to NFL Draft Promise

As the NFL Draft approaches, football enthusiasts focus their attention on upcoming talents ready to make their mark in the professional league. Among these athletes is Ashton Jeanty, whose path to this moment is uniquely intertwined with his family's military background. This promising Boise State Broncos running back is poised to enter the NFL's spotlight, leveraging lessons from his father’s military career as he embraces the next step of his journey.

Jeanty is on the verge of fulfilling his dream. The anticipation surrounding his potential as a first-round pick is palpable. His journey, however, is marked by a blend of athletic prowess and life lessons gleaned from his father, Harry Jeanty, a Navy veteran. The parallels between military service requirements and the rigorous evaluations athletes face in the NFL Draft are quite profound, as Ashton shared in an interview with Fox News Digital: "Before you get into the military, they do various tests, MRIs, screenings. It's the same way that's in the draft and combine."

The comparability of these experiences isn't merely an abstract notion for Jeanty; it's a lived experience that came to life when he visited the General Mitchell Air National Guard Base in Milwaukee with his father. This visit, organized with the support of USAA, a Salute to Service partner, allowed Jeanty to directly engage with military life, far beyond the lens of video games like Call of Duty. Reflecting on this experience, he noted, "It was cool to see their daily process and how detailed everything is, what they're doing on a daily basis. We wouldn't be able to do what we do without their service."

Jeanty's reflections not only underscore a respect for military precision but highlight his growing understanding of the demanding nature of both sectors. Maturing has offered him insights into his father's experiences in the Navy, sharing, "He wouldn't give too much detail exactly on what they were doing. Now that I'm older, he tells me about stuff that happened on the ship and stuff like that."

In the world of sports, Jeanty’s performance speaks for itself. Last season, he was second only to Barry Sanders' historic rushing record, solidifying his status as a significant player to watch.
